Halloween Forecast Outlook

What to Expect for Costumes & Trick 'or' Treaters

The last few Maryland Halloween's have been on the cool side with highs only in the upper 50s. This year is expected to be slightly milder, with temps in the 60s for the first time in 3 years. The reason for this expected change this year is the lack of warm or cold air advection, or movement. This pattern will keep us rather neutral as far as temperature swings are concerned.

One forecast trend we'll have to watch is the potential for rain Monday night (Oct. 31st). There will be a baroclinic zone of instability within the area which could produce an area of low pressure near the Mid- Atlantic. This would bring some rain to the area - but the reliability of the models is not as good two weeks out. We'll post another forecast outlook next week.

Our Previous Halloweens:

October 31st, 2015 High: 59° Low: 34°

October 31st, 2014 High: 57° Low: 46°

October 31st, 2013 High: 69° Low: 53°
